Output 8b08e6af913a492340ddd711b661daa291ed07b2116ee6e1c19a9d9dc00b1fa5:2

value
43061848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 401d66df25595b3addf757e7ee47d7826389eca8 OP_EQUAL
address
37Y2PhN3V5PZm5X5TbRZUA6p5DDTjGnoWj
transaction
8b08e6af913a492340ddd711b661daa291ed07b2116ee6e1c19a9d9dc00b1fa5
confirmations
266980
spent
true